Koishikawa Korakuen is one of Tokyo's oldest surviving gardens, laid out in the early Edo period around a central pond, with miniature renderings of Chinese and Japanese landscapes set around the circuit. Admission is ¥300 and it opens 9:00 AM–4:30 PM. Allow about an hour.
